Transaction de3f96e5575ce50e717e0aac10e849cd9c19820a4a14cb2a3ae5a9d9fa8125cf
1 Input
1 Output
-
de3f96e5575ce50e717e0aac10e849cd9c19820a4a14cb2a3ae5a9d9fa8125cf:0
- value
- 43476628
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0235b433e6c5b581e44a76326a5bb9ba09dd906
- address
- bc1q6q34kse7d3d4s8jy5a3jdfdmnwsfmkgx745ky9